What laptop should I buy for learning X-Code and Swift

Hello all, a newcomer here with I’m assuming a typical newcomers question!


I am relatively new to coding, just getting into learning X-Code/Swift and hope to start to develop some simple apps within a year or 2. I have been doing some research on the best Mac to buy to meet these needs; but seem to get different answers everywhere. I’m hoping that can be put to rest here. Below are the two that I am debating between, and would love to hear everyone’s opinions.


*Note: I was hoping to spend under $2000.

** This laptop would just be used mainly for learning to use X-Code and Swift. I can’t see myself getting too into video/photo editing or anything like that especially if I am still just learning. By the time I need to actually edit graphics and stuff for my apps I’d hope to upgrade. I wouldn’t keep photos or videos on the laptop, as I have a PC for that; which is why I believe 256GB would be fine.


1) Macbook Air (13-Inch) (I am leaning towards this at the time of posting this thread)

Would purchase an extra screen to eliminate the “screen estate” issue

Specs:

  • 2.2GHz dual-core Intel Core i7 processor
  • 8GB 1600MHz LPDDR3 memory
  • 256GB SSD storage
  • Intel HD Graphics 6000

Total price ~$1,850CAD from the Apple Store


2) Macbook (12-Inch)

Would purchase an extra screen to eliminate the “screen estate” issue

Specs:

  • 1.2GHz dual-core 7th-generation Intel Core m3 processor
  • 8GB 1866MHz LPDDR3 memory
  • 256GB SSD storage
  • Intel HD Graphics 615

Total price ~$1,953.77CAD from the Apple Store


Any help is greatly appreciated! What other specs should I keep an eye out for?
